Token Launches Have Always Been Priced in Something That Moves. On Arc, They Aren't.

Every token launch of the past decade carried a flaw that had nothing to do with the token being launched.

It was the gas.

When a team deploys a token contract, locks liquidity behind a timelock, or releases a vesting tranche to contributors, each of those actions costs money denominated in an asset whose own price is in motion. A launch budgeted at a fixed dollar figure on Monday costs something different by Thursday. Transactions that fail during volatility cost real money and return nothing at all. A distribution schedule running eighteen months forward forces a treasury to hold a reserve of a volatile asset for no reason other than paying to move its own tokens.

The industry absorbed this the way you absorb weather. It is not weather. It is a design decision, and Arc is the first Layer-1 arriving at institutional scale to make a different one.

As of today, TrustSwap is live on Arc.

The unit of account was always the part that was broken

Arc is an open, EVM-compatible Layer-1 built for real financial markets, and its defining choice is that transaction fees are denominated in dollars rather than in a volatile network asset. Stablecoins are gas, starting with USDC.

That sounds like a convenience feature. It is closer to a change in the unit of account, and units of account decide what kinds of businesses can exist on a platform.

Consider what becomes possible when the cost of an onchain action is a known dollar figure eighteen months out. A vesting contract can be budgeted the way a payroll run is budgeted. A launch can be quoted to a client as a fixed cost rather than an estimate with a volatility disclaimer attached. A treasury can stop holding an unrelated asset purely as an operating expense buffer. None of that is exotic. It is how every other category of financial software already works, and crypto has spent a decade pretending the alternative was acceptable because there was no alternative.

Arc pairs that with deterministic finality in under 500 milliseconds — a block that closes is final, not probabilistically final — and a fee model that smooths demand across a weighted moving average rather than adjusting block by block. Execution runs on Reth. Consensus runs on Malachite, a Byzantine Fault Tolerant engine derived from Tendermint. The engineering is deliberately unglamorous. That is the point.

The strongest argument against all of this

Here is the case against, made properly.

Day-one partner lists are marketing artifacts. Every chain launch produces one. Most of the names on most of those lists ship a deployment, publish a post, and never touch the network again. Skepticism toward a company announcing it is live on a new chain is well-earned skepticism.

The technical claim is also less novel than it sounds. Paying gas in a stablecoin has been possible through paymasters and account abstraction on other networks for years. Arc is not inventing dollar-denominated fees so much as making them the default rather than a workaround.

And the sharpest objection is one we should not dodge: Arc's validator set is permissioned. Participation is currently selected on operational resilience, geographic distribution, and regulatory compliance, and the eleven institutions announced in August — among them BlackRock, DTCC, ICE, Mastercard, Standard Chartered, and Visa — are not a set anyone would describe as permissionless. If your position is that a chain validated by regulated financial institutions is a database with extra steps, that position is coherent. It is not a strawman and it should not be waved away.

Why we built anyway

We take the permissioning objection seriously, and our answer is not that it does not matter. It is that it is a real trade, openly made, and different applications will weigh it differently.

A memecoin launch has no reason to care about a geographically distributed institutional validator set. A tokenized treasury product or a corporate payroll run in stablecoins cares enormously, because the counterparties involved cannot transact on infrastructure that settles probabilistically and prices its fees in an asset their auditors will question. Those two use cases were never going to share a chain, and the past four years of everyone pretending otherwise produced a lot of infrastructure that served neither well.

Our position is the boring one. We do not need to know which chain wins. Team Finance has shipped across many networks for years precisely because the token management problem is identical everywhere and the chain underneath is an implementation detail. Being live on Arc from block one is not a bet on Arc displacing anything. It is a bet that a chain where a dollar costs a dollar will attract a class of builder who was never going to show up otherwise, and that those builders will need liquidity locks and vesting schedules exactly like everyone else.

If Arc succeeds, the infrastructure is already there. If it does not, we built tooling for a network in a week and learned something. That asymmetry is why you support a chain on day one instead of waiting for the data.
